Netherlands - Stichting Klachten en Geschillen Zorgverzekeringen (SKGZ)

  • alternative dispute resolution body

Overview

Info fees

Costs for the consumer
The Health Insurance Ombudsman does not charge for its mediation services. The cost of handling a complaint filed with the complaints committee is EUR 37.00. If the insured party is successful, the fee for filing a complaint shall be reimbursed to that party.

Costs for the company
The Insurer pays a membership fee and an annual contribution to cover the handling of complaints.
